Jump to content
Regnidor

Frage zu den Leistungseinstellungen insb. Overrides

Recommended Posts

Habe gerade gesehen, dass bei mir in den Erweiterten Einstellungen -> Leistung

 

"Alle Overrides deaktivieren" aktiviert ist.

 

Ist das richtig so? Müsste das nicht auf "Nein" stehen?

Share this post


Link to post
Share on other sites

Das müsste auf Nein stehen; Sobald irgendeine Erweiterung was "überschriebenes""overriddennes":-) braucht um zu funktionieren...würde irgendwas nicht funzen

Edited by kulli (see edit history)

Share this post


Link to post
Share on other sites

Mist, das habe ich mir fast gedacht. Wenn ich es aber auf NEIN stelle, komme ich nicht mehr ins BO rein, weil dann EU Rechtssicherheit Probleme macht.

 

Das hat ich ja schon mal (finde den thread nicht mehr), dachte ich hätte das Problem gelöst. Nix war`s. Mist werde noch wahnsinnig.

 

Kann damit jemand was anfangen:

 

Unknown error in Zeile 58 der Datei /modules/advancedeucompliance/advancedeucompliance.php
[4096] Argument 1 passed to Advancedeucompliance::__construct() must be an instance of Core_Foundation_Database_EntityManager, none given, called in /override/classes/module/Module.php on line 164 and defined

Unknown error in Zeile 59 der Datei modules/advancedeucompliance/advancedeucompliance.php
[4096] Argument 2 passed to Advancedeucompliance::__construct() must be an instance of Core_Foundation_FileSystem_FileSystem, none given, called in override/classes/module/Module.php on line 164 and defined

Unknown error in Zeile 60 der Datei modules/advancedeucompliance/advancedeucompliance.php
[4096] Argument 3 passed to Advancedeucompliance::__construct() must be an instance of Core_Business_Email_EmailLister, none given, called in override/classes/module/Module.php on line 164 and defined

Notice in Zeile 73 der Datei modules/advancedeucompliance/advancedeucompliance.php
[8] Undefined variable: entity_manager

Notice in Zeile 74 der Datei modules/advancedeucompliance/advancedeucompliance.php
[8] Undefined variable: fs

Notice in Zeile 75 der Datei modules/advancedeucompliance/advancedeucompliance.php
[8] Undefined variable: email

 

 

 

Wenn ich EU Rechtssicherheit deinstalliere uind lösche, dann funktioniert das BO wieder, auch wenn die Overrides ausgeschaltet sind.

Wenn ich es dann wieder installiere, bekomme ich den gleichen Fehler...

 

Jemand ne Ahnung wie ich das wieder ordentlich zum Laufen bekomme?

Edited by Regnidor (see edit history)

Share this post


Link to post
Share on other sites

für advanced eu compliance sollte keine modul.php im override/classes/module ordner sein

 

dieses modul.php muss also woanders herkommen

 

verbessert mich, wenns anders sein sollte; bei mir ist es so. (1.6.1.0)

 

(Datensicherung, Datensicherung, Datensicherung)

 

benenne es doch mal testweise um und sieh was passiert

 

Edit: in einer 0.14 ist diese datei noch vorhanden (von eu_legal ?)

Edited by kulli (see edit history)

Share this post


Link to post
Share on other sites

Hmm ich habe die module.php jetzt mal umbenannt und jetzt funktioniert es.

 

Aber das kann ja nicht die Lösung des Problems sein.

 

Wo kommt die module.php her?

Wenn nicht von adv. eu c, warum greift adv. eu c dann darauf zu ???

 

Irgendein Modul (wenn nicht adv eu c) wird diese module.php ja irgendwie brauchen, oder?

Share this post


Link to post
Share on other sites

Okay das Back Office funktioniert und ich bekomme keine Fehlermeldung, aber der Shop funktioniert nicht.

 

Alle Produkte sind weg...

 

Hab die Overrides wieder deaktiviert. Könnte echt kotzen...

Edited by Regnidor (see edit history)

Share this post


Link to post
Share on other sites

Hier mal die Zeile 164 der module.php in denen der Fehler verursacht wird:

$tmp_module = new $module;

Die Zeilen 58-60 der advancedeucompliance.php sehen so aus:

 public function __construct(Core_Foundation_Database_EntityManager $entity_manager,
                                Core_Foundation_FileSystem_FileSystem $fs,
                                Core_Business_Email_EmailLister $email)

Kann da jemand etwas damit anfangen???

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More